  10. I am helping some of the young men at my church group prepare for a 206 miles bike ride over 3 days next summer. Any ideas on how to get them trained for such an adventure?

    • Tony
      Tony

      Nothing beats building up steady miles in the bank. Pace doesn't seem to matter much, but the miles do.

      3 months ago Like

    • Show 2 more comments...
    • Dale T.

      I agree... Miles, miles, and more miles!

      3 months ago Like

    • Jeremy B.
      Jeremy B.

      Is this road or MTB? As with everyone else miles in the saddle are key. Be sure to set some small goals for small distances. When they see they can easily do 25 - 50 miles in a day then they will know the 206 miles is achievable. Is this the LOTOJA route? Just curious.

      3 months ago Like
